递归实现回文判断(如:abcdedbca就是回文,判断一个面试者对递归理解的简单程序)


Posted in 面试题 onApril 28, 2013
int find(char *str, int n) {
if(n else if(str[0]==str[n-1]) return find(str+1, n-2);
else return 0;
}
int main(int argc, char* argv[]) {
char *str = “abcdedcba”;
printf(“%s: %s\n”, str, find(str, strlen(str)) ? “Yes” : “No”);
}

Tags in this post...

面试题 相关文章推荐
接口中的方法可以是abstract的吗
Jul 23 面试题
为什么要有struct关键字
May 08 面试题
.NET面试题:什么是值类型和引用类型
Jan 12 面试题
网上常见的一份Linux面试题(多项选择部分)
Feb 07 面试题
Linux管理员面试题 Linux admin interview questions
Nov 01 面试题
软件测试笔试题
Oct 25 面试题
数字天堂软件测试面试题
Dec 23 面试题
MIS软件工程师的面试题
Apr 22 面试题
AJAX的全称是什么
Nov 06 面试题
XML文档定义有几种形式?它们之间有何本质区别?解析XML文档有哪几种方式?
Jan 12 面试题
Ruby如何定义一个类
Oct 08 面试题
介绍一下SOA和SOA的基本特征
Feb 24 面试题
C语言面试题
May 19 #面试题
C有"按引用传递"吗
Sep 06 #面试题
求高于平均分的学生学号及成绩
Sep 01 #面试题
上海方立数码笔试题
Oct 18 #面试题
在C中是否有模拟继承等面向对象程序设计特性的好方法
May 22 #面试题
main 主函数执行完毕后,是否可能会再执行一段代码,给出说明
Dec 05 #面试题
在C语言中实现抽象数据类型什么方法最好
Jun 26 #面试题
You might like
Laravel框架定时任务2种实现方式示例
2018/12/08 PHP
PHP使用Redis实现Session共享的实现示例
2019/05/12 PHP
Javascript 文件夹选择框的两种解决方案
2009/07/01 Javascript
JavaScript 题型问答有答案参考
2010/02/17 Javascript
用JS控制回车事件的代码
2011/02/20 Javascript
JS实现随机化快速排序的实例代码
2013/08/01 Javascript
JS 删除字符串最后一个字符的实现代码
2014/02/20 Javascript
jQuery菜单插件superfish使用指南
2015/04/21 Javascript
深入理解jQuery之事件移除
2016/06/02 Javascript
JQuery实现定时刷新功能代码
2017/05/09 jQuery
Bootstrap 3多级下拉菜单实例
2017/11/23 Javascript
jQuery轮播图实例详解
2018/08/15 jQuery
vue实现的微信机器人聊天功能案例【附源码下载】
2019/02/18 Javascript
Vue列表循环从指定下标开始的多种解决方案
2020/04/08 Javascript
Element Tooltip 文字提示的使用示例
2020/07/26 Javascript
mustache.js实现首页元件动态渲染的示例代码
2020/12/28 Javascript
[02:05]2014DOTA2西雅图邀请赛 专访啸天mik夫妻档
2014/07/08 DOTA
python使用Image处理图片常用技巧分析
2015/06/01 Python
python中找出numpy array数组的最值及其索引方法
2018/04/17 Python
influx+grafana自定义python采集数据和一些坑的总结
2018/09/17 Python
pandas 数据归一化以及行删除例程的方法
2018/11/10 Python
Python 创建新文件时避免覆盖已有的同名文件的解决方法
2018/11/16 Python
Python制作exe文件简单流程
2019/01/24 Python
使用 Django Highcharts 实现数据可视化过程解析
2019/07/31 Python
python 字符串常用方法汇总详解
2019/09/16 Python
python  logging日志打印过程解析
2019/10/22 Python
通过celery异步处理一个查询任务的完整代码
2019/11/19 Python
Python实现FLV视频拼接功能
2020/01/21 Python
UNDONE手表官网:世界领先的定制手表品牌
2018/11/13 全球购物
实习教师自我鉴定
2013/12/09 职场文书
授权委托书怎么写
2014/09/25 职场文书
单位考核聘任报告
2015/03/02 职场文书
解决SpringCloud Feign传对象参数调用失败的问题
2021/06/23 Java/Android
详解redis在微服务领域的贡献
2021/10/16 Redis
MYSQL事务的隔离级别与MVCC
2022/05/25 MySQL
Go微服务项目配置文件的定义和读取示例详解
2022/06/21 Golang